WellWrite is a free app (with additional levels for a nominal fee) which displays four possible answers (including the occasional "none"), and you have to click on the correct spelling. Simple and addictive.

Of course, you can share your brilliance with others (and compete with them) on Facebook, Twitter and Google+.
It also features a pretty soothing music track while playing the game.
This fun app is perfect for anyone who either thinks they're a good speller or wants to become one (because they rely WAY too much on spellcheck and autocorrect).
